Founded on October 20, 1972, and opened to 88 students on March 20, 1973, the Escuela Colombiana de Ingeniería Julio Garavito is a private, specialized engineering university in Bogotá. Named after the eminent astronomer Julio Garavito, it focuses on engineering excellence and technical-humanistic education.

Founded on October 20, 1972, and inaugurated on March 24, 1973, ECI is a private, non-profit specialized engineering university located in Bogotá.
ECI currently enrolls approximately 4,600 students, offering 8 undergraduate programs, 17 specializations, 11 master’s, and 1 doctoral program.
It uniquely integrates advanced labs (like H‑block with Latin America’s largest structural testing wall), historic campus grounds, and a strong focus on engineering quality, earning both national and international accreditations.
